OPINION BY President Judge LEADBETTER.

In this appeal, we are asked to determine which entity, the non-utility generation facility or the electric distribution company, owns alternative energy credits where the power purchase agreement executed by the two entities is silent on the issue. This occurred because the contract was entered into before the creation of alternative energy credits in 2005 by the Alternative Energy Portfolio Standards Act (AEPS).
